Bria Beaufort focuses her practice on management-side employment litigation and counseling. She represents companies and managers in employment litigation filed in federal and state courts, as well as administrative agencies in various matters including discrimination, harassment, and retaliation. Ms. Beaufort’s practice also includes conducting workplace investigations and pre-litigation resolution of employment disputes. In addition, she provides counseling regarding workplace laws, employer policies, and investigations by administrative agencies.

Bria Beaufort serves as a Trustee for the Essex County Bar Association.
